iPad Disable Connect to itunes

Hi To all.


My iPad status is "iPad is disabled connect to itunes" after my younger brohter tried to open it without knowing the right passcode. Then I follow the instruction I connected it to my itunes on pc but itunes say's that I have to enter the passcode first before the iPad connect to itunes. the problem is the log-in page of my ipad is not showing and the only display is "iPad is Disabled" even if I shutdown my iPad. Please Help. Thank you very much!

You will still need to connect it to a computer that is running iTunes in order to unlock it (and you may need to put the iPad into recovery mode : http://support.apple.com/kb/ht1808) - if you have some of your content on your computer you can then copy it back. Also depending on which country that you are in you might also be able to re-download some of your iTunes purchases if you don't have copies of them.
